    The Ai Music Generation Challenge 2020: Double Jigs in the Style of O'Neill's 1001 by Bob Sturm, Hugo Maruri-Aguilar

    Published 2021-12-01
    “…This article describes and analyses the Ai Music Generation Challenge 2020, where seven participants competed to build artificial systems that generate the most plausible double jigs, as judged against the 365 published in The Dance Music of Ireland: O'Neill's 1001 (1907). The outcomes of this challenge demonstrate how music generation systems can be meaningfully evaluated, and furthermore that the generation of plausible double jigs has yet to be "solved". …”
